As the Senior OSS Enginer (Linux, Docker, Kubernetes), you will be responsible for leading day-to-day delivery, support, and availability of the FUJIFILM Biotechnologies Global Infrastructure, this includes but is not limited to build, configure, administer, and support infrastructure technologies and solutions. These technologies and solutions can include computing, storage, networking, physical infrastructure, software, commercial-off-the-shelf software (COTS), and open-source packages and solutions. They can also include containerized, virtual and cloud computing such as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S), Platform as a Service (PaaS) and Software as a Service (SaaS).

In this role, you will aid in design and implement standard information security and security controls that can be used to mitigate security threats within our solutions and services. You will aid in the technical design and delivery of our global projects ensuring ROI and best value are delivered. Responsible for the capacity management, business continuity and backup of all FDB platform hosted systems. The role also has the responsibility for QoS in regard to the infrastructure platform, as such will create SOP's and procedures that drives and ensures this.

Minimum Education and Experience Requirements

You have 8 yrs+ experience in an IT 3rd/ 4th line position with proven track record in an enterprise IT infrastructure environment, or 3+ years' experience of working in a biomedical IT service environment. Any combination of education and experience, which would provide an equivalent background to deliver against role expectations.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

  • In depth design and support knowledge of Infrastructure technologies such as but not limited to RHEL, VMWare, Windows Server 2012-2022, Citrix, Hyperconverged, Ansible, Satellite, Debian

  • Experience with Backup/Replication Technologies such as Veeam

  • Strong experience building and managing enterprise Linux systems.

  • Strong experience building and managing containerized platforms (e.g., docker, kubernetes)

  • Experience with opensource projects and licenses.

  • Strong experience with cloud infrastructure plat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ure)

  • Strong experience of infrastructure storage solutions including design, build and administration.

  • In depth knowledge of Infrastructure security and associated frameworks such as ISO27000

  • Understanding of networking principles, including T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, NTP, and VPN

  • Solid business acumen and at-ease when engaging with senior leadership.

  • In depth experience of scripting and automation technologies

  • Experience of tracking emerging IT issues, strategies, roadmaps, patterns, and technologies over time to assess opportunities to enhance service delivery.

  • Adept at communicating with technical and non-technical stakeholders at all levels, and across organizations, using architecture communication techniques.

  • Adept at gaining support from business and technical stakeholders for IT initiatives with low/medium levels of risk, impact, and complexity.

  • Understanding of security regarding open-source technologies
